DERS ADI

: C# ile Pratik Veritabanı Programlama

Ders Bilgileri

Ders Kodu Ders Adı Ders Türü D U L AKTS
CSC 5040 C# ile Pratik Veritabanı Programlama SEÇMELİ 3 0 0 8

Dersi Veren Birim

Fen Bilimleri Enstitüsü

Dersin Düzeyi

Yüksek Lisans

Ders Koordinatörü

PROF.DR. EFENDİ NASİBOĞLU

Dersi Alan Birimler

Bilgisayar Bilimleri Yüksek Lisans
Bilgisayar Bilimleri Doktora

Dersin Amacı

Dersin temel hedefi C# aracılığıyla Microsoft Access, SQL Server vs. ilişkisel veritabanlarını kullanabilen programları oluşturma tekniklerinin öğretilmesi olacaktır. Programların tasarımında Visual Studio görsel tasarım araçları ve Runtime nesneleri kullanılacaktır.

Dersin Öğrenme Kazanımları

1   İlişkisel veritabanlarının temel kavramlarını bilmek
2   ADO.NET bileşenlerini bilmek
3   Visual C# ile SQL Server kullanımını bilmek
4   Visual C# ile LINQ kullanımını bilmek
5   .NET konsepti kullanarak çeşitli veritabanları oluşturabilmek

Dersin Öğretim Türü

Örgün Öğretim

Dersin Önkoşulu/Önkoşulları

Yok

Ders İçin Önerilen Diğer Hususlar

Yok

Ders İçeriği

Hafta Konular Açıklama
1 Giriş
2 Veritabanları ve Veritabanı programları
3 ADO.NET e giriş.
4 LINQ (Language-Integrated Query) giriş.
5 Visual Studio görsel tasarım araçlarıyla veri sorgulama
6 Runtime nesneleriyle veri sorgulama
7 Visual Studio görsel tasarım araçlarıyla veri ekleme.
8 Runtime nesneleriyle veri ekleme.
9 Visual Studio görsel tasarım araçlarıyla veri yenileme ve silme.
10 Runtime nesneleriyle veri yenileme ve silme.
11 ASP.NET te veri kullanımı
12 ASP.NET Web hizmetleri
13 Proje değerlendirmesi
14 Genel değerlendirmeler

Ders İçin Önerilen Kaynaklar

Ying Bai , Practical Database Programming With Visual C#.NET, John Wiley and Sons Ltd, 2010
Sefer Algan, Her Yönüyle C#, Pusula Yayıncılık ve İletişim, 2013

Öğrenme ve Öğretme Yöntemleri

Değerlendirme Yöntemleri

SIRA NO KISA KOD UZUN ADI FORMUL
1 PRJ PROJE
2 YSBN YIL SONU BAŞARI NOTU PRJ * 1


*** Bütünleme Sınavı Yapılmayan Birimlerde Bütünleme Kriteri Dikkate Alınmaz.

Değerlendirme Yöntemlerine İliskin Aciklamalar

Yok

Değerlendirme Kriteri

İlan Edilecektir.

Dersin Öğretim Dili

İngilizce

Derse İlişkin Politika ve Kurallar

İlan Edilecektir.

Dersin Öğretim Üyesi İletişim Bilgileri

efendi.nasibov@deu.edu.tr

Ders Öğretim Üyesi Görüşme Gün ve Saatleri

İlan Edilecektir.

Staj Durumu

YOK

İş Yükü Hesaplaması

Etkinlikler Sayısı Süresi (saat) Toplam İş Yükü (saat)
Ders Anlatımı 13 3 39
Haftalık Ders öncesi/sonrası hazırlıklar 13 4 52
Final Sınavına Hazırlık 1 15 15
Ödev Hazırlama 4 20 80
Sunum Hazırlama 4 5 20
Final Sınavı 1 2 2
TOPLAM İŞ YÜKÜ (saat) 208

Program ve Öğrenme Kazanımları İlişkisi

PK/ÖKPK.1PK.2PK.3PK.4PK.5PK.6PK.7PK.8PK.9PK.10
ÖK.1555
ÖK.2555
ÖK.3555
ÖK.4555
ÖK.5555